cap draper
California’s Six-State Split Makes it to Ballot, Still a Dumb Idea
July 16, 2014
wind powered data center 20140723 191603 1
5 Unusually Powered Data Centers
July 23, 2014
 Image Alt
This website uses cookies to improve your experience. By using this website you agree to our Data Protection Policy.
Read more